To test power transformer windings, you can perform several key tests. First, use a megohmmeter to check insulation resistance between windings and ground, ensuring it meets manufacturer specifications. Next, conduct a turns ratio test with a transformer turns ratio tester to verify the winding ratios. Additionally, perform a winding resistance test using a low-resistance ohmmeter to check for continuity and detect any shorted turns. Finally, consider insulation power factor testing for further assessment of winding condition.
